    Coolant Leak

    I first noticed yesterday morning on the drive into work, my temp needle shot straight up to the red whenever I took the revs up to around 2500. Once I was in work I noticed that the coolant level was extremely low!

    I left it til lunch, when I topped up the header tank and took for a quick spin around camp. After a few minutes I parked back up and let her cool and checked the level. It was fine!

    I then chacked before the drive home and all was well. I forgot to check after I parked up at home last nite. However this morning I noticed the header tank was empty! I filled her up and went on my way to work. I managed to keep the revs below 2500 and the temp gauge seemed normal! After reaching work and parking up i left her too stand until lunch. At this point I checked and the header tank was empty again!.

    I can see no obvious signs of where the leak could be coming from as the fluid is leaking onto the undertray which is collecting it then spilling it over the edges.

    Anybody had this happen before or have any idea what could be wrong? As its collecting on the undertray am I right to believe its coming from the front of the engine?

    Any help will be much appreciated.

    also check the radiator hasn't got a hair line crack in the plastic bit just below cap (very common place to crack ) the crack would expand and leak with heat and pressure but maybe you will not see without a very close look and putting a bit of pressure on the plastic with your hand.

    Check the end of the pipe that goes into the engine under the air box that is where I found my leak ! If the engine isn't hot it drips a little but if engine is hot it evaporates , look for orange or green sludge marks on the joints is the give away !
